Cómo preparar Jello Pastel Cookies
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Line baking sheets with parchment paper.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our and 2 teaspoons baking powder. Set aside.
- In a large bowl, cream together 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ter and 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ar using an electric mixer until light and fluffy.
- Gradually add 1 (3-ounce) package of unflavored gelatin (dry), beating until well combined.
- Beat in 2 large eggs one at a time, then stir in 1 teaspoon vanilla extract.
- Gradually add the dry flour mixture to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
- Roll dough into 1-inch balls.
- Place dough balls 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heets.
- Gently flatten each ball with the bottom of a clean glass.
- Sprinkle the remaining 1 (3-ounce) package of unflavored gelatin over the flattened cookies.
- Bake for 8-10 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den brown.
- Remove cookies from baking sheets and let cool completely on a wire rack.
- Store in an airtight container at room temperature.
